+/**
+ * This is a test harness designed to handle responding to UI during the process
+ * of installing an XPI. A test can set callbacks to hear about specific parts
+ * of the sequence.
+ * Before use setup must be called and finish must be called afterwards.
+ */
+var Harness = {
+ // If set then the callback is called when an install is attempted and
+ // software installation is disabled.
+ installDisabledCallback: null,
+ // If set then the callback is called when an install is attempted and
+ // then canceled.
+ installCancelledCallback: null,
+ // If set then the callback will be called when an install's origin is blocked.
+ installOriginBlockedCallback: null,
+ // If set then the callback will be called when an install is blocked by the
+ // whitelist. The callback should return true to continue with the install
+ // anyway.
+ installBlockedCallback: null,
+ // If set will be called in the event of authentication being needed to get
+ // the xpi. Should return a 2 element array of username and password, or
+ // null to not authenticate.
+ authenticationCallback: null,
+ // If set this will be called to allow checking the contents of the xpinstall
+ // confirmation dialog. The callback should return true to continue the install.
+ installConfirmCallback: null,
+ // If set will be called when downloading of an item has begun.
+ downloadStartedCallback: null,
+ // If set will be called during the download of an item.
+ downloadProgressCallback: null,
+ // If set will be called when an xpi fails to download.
+ downloadFailedCallback: null,
+ // If set will be called when an xpi download is cancelled.
+ downloadCancelledCallback: null,
+ // If set will be called when downloading of an item has ended.
+ downloadEndedCallback: null,
+ // If set will be called when installation by the extension manager of an xpi
+ // item starts
+ installStartedCallback: null,
+ // If set will be called when an xpi fails to install.
+ installFailedCallback: null,
+ // If set will be called when each xpi item to be installed completes
+ // installation.
+ installEndedCallback: null,
+ // If set will be called when all triggered items are installed or the install
+ // is canceled.
+ installsCompletedCallback: null,
+ // If set the harness will wait for this DOM event before calling
+ // installsCompletedCallback
+ finalContentEvent: null,
+
+ waitingForEvent: false,
+ pendingCount: null,
+ installCount: null,
+ runningInstalls: null,
+
+ waitingForFinish: false,
+
+ // A unique value to return from the installConfirmCallback to indicate that
+ // the install UI shouldn't be closed automatically
+ leaveOpen: {},
